This role provides comprehensive care management and social work case management services to elderly individuals and adults with physical and intellectual disabilities, helping them live as independently as possible in the community. The Care Manager collaborates closely with an RN Care Manager and an interdisciplinary team to assess member needs, develop and implement member-centered care plans, coordinate services, and ensure quality and continuity of care. This position offers a weekday schedule and the opportunity to contribute meaningfully within a mission-driven program focused on community-based support.
ResponsibilitiesThis position is based in an office setting in Rock County, Wisconsin, with the first day of orientation conducted at a Vliet location. The standard work schedule is Monday through Friday, 8: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m., providing a consistent weekday routine. The role involves regular travel within Rock County to meet with members, families, and community partners, requiring a valid driver’s license, a personal vehicle, and appropriate insurance coverage. Work is performed in a professional healthcare and social services environment that emphasizes team collaboration, use of healthcare management systems, and adherence to documentation and quality standards. The culture is mission-driven, focusing on helping elderly individuals and adults with physical and intellectual disabilities remain as independent as possible in the community, with opportunities for close teamwork, community-based case management, and meaningful member relationships.
